headroom vs agent-bounties

headroom: Headroom compresses everything your AI agent reads — tool outputs, logs, RAG chunks, files, and conversation history — before it reaches the LLM. It achieves the same answers with a fraction of the tokens.; agent-bounties: Agent Bounties is an open-source marketplace and protocol enabling AI agents to find, claim, complete, verify, and get paid for digital work using Base USDC. It provides a structured environment for agents to interact with bounties and for users to post tasks.

Features

headroom logoheadroom
01In-app library for compression (Python/TypeScript)
02Zero-code-change proxy mode
03One-command agent wrapping for various AI agents
04Cross-agent shared memory and auto-deduplication
05Reversible compression (CCR) with original content retrieval
agent-bounties logoagent-bounties
01AI-agent bounty marketplace
02Decentralized protocol for task verification and payment
03Supports various agent interfaces and hosts
04Local development environment for API and MCP services
05Objective compiler for task breakdown
